Output 8d11ff7e09d636c8436bf97d6c2939eecbd48728b923ef3ffb8076f478f11082:3

value
1869959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f063ec33790491f0edd90cda85862d7c6a4afe6c OP_EQUAL
address
3Pc5oLATaEEDQwMYm1c3isrq5P76585B9r
transaction
8d11ff7e09d636c8436bf97d6c2939eecbd48728b923ef3ffb8076f478f11082
confirmations
102948
spent
true